CAS 7508-99-8
:1-(3-Fluorophenyl)-1H-pyrrole-2,5-dione
Description:
1-(3-Fluorophenyl)-1H-pyrrole-2,5-dione, with the CAS number 7508-99-8, is an organic compound characterized by its unique structure, which includes a pyrrole ring substituted with a fluorophenyl group. This compound typically exhibits a yellow to orange color and is known for its potential applications in pharmaceuticals and organic synthesis due to its reactive carbonyl groups. The presence of the fluorine atom enhances its electronic properties, potentially influencing its reactivity and biological activity. As a diketone, it can participate in various chemical reactions, including nucleophilic additions and cycloadditions. The compound's solubility may vary depending on the solvent, but it is generally soluble in organic solvents. Its stability can be affected by environmental factors such as light and moisture, necessitating careful handling and storage. Overall, 1-(3-Fluorophenyl)-1H-pyrrole-2,5-dione is of interest in both research and industrial applications, particularly in the development of new materials and therapeutic agents.
Formula:C10H6FNO2
InChI:InChI=1/C10H6FNO2/c11-7-2-1-3-8(6-7)12-9(13)4-5-10(12)14/h1-6H
SMILES:c1cc(cc(c1)N1C(=O)C=CC1=O)F
Synonyms:- 1H-Pyrrole-2,5-dione, 1-(3-fluorophenyl)-
